    Mamba is a 1930 [1] American pre-Code film, released by Tiffany Pictures. It was shot entirely in Technicolor and stars Jean Hersholt , Eleanor Boardman , Ralph Forbes , Josef Swickard , Claude Fleming, William Stanton and William von Brincken.

    The Black Mamba is an American short film produced, written, and directed by Robert Rodriguez. It stars Kobe Bryant , Kanye West , Danny Trejo , and Bruce Willis . The Black Mamba was released by Nike online on February 19, 2011.
